The Australian Social Work Clinical Practice Guidelines 2017

The Australian Social Work Clinical Practice Guidelines 2017

Guidelines for Social Work in Cystic Fibrosis, primarily for health professionals but of interest to other people living with CF. These guidelines provide recommendations for social work practice at development stages across the lifespan of CF. These recommendations endeavour to accommodate the needs of each individual patient and the practices and systems of each CF care centre. Depression, Anxiety and CF

Depression, Anxiety and CF

Article from CFA on what the International mental health, depression and anxiety guidelines mean for for people living with CF. Includes a summary of the recommendations from guidelines for people with cystic fibrosis and parents who take care of children with CF to help understand the impact of CF on depression and anxiety.
